Domestic Abuse is a raw and unsettling portrait of a woman's descent into the dark realities of an abusive marriage. The pacing feels deliberate, almost suffocating at times, reflecting the entrapment of the protagonist. It's a TV movie from the early '90s that doesn't shy away from exploring heavy themes like power dynamics and societal expectations. The performances are quite striking; the lead embodies the struggle with a palpable intensity, making each scene resonate with a haunting quality. There's an eerie atmosphere that looms throughout, underpinned by a stark realism that keeps it grounded. For collectors, it's one of those gems that offers a unique glimpse into the complexities of domestic life, layered with unsettling truths.
